It appears that Disney is recycling the iconic art style of the now canceled Disney Infinity video game series to create a new line of action figures.
As discovered by Twitter user Infiniteer Adventures, an ad has been put on the shopDisney website for “TOYBOX Action Figures” that simply states, “Get ready to interact with PIXAR, Star Wars and Marvel characters like never before. Online and in-store Friday, November 3.”
The Rey and Storm Trooper figures shown above clearly resemble the distinguished art style that the Disney Infinity series was so well known for. Also, the name TOYBOX Action Figures seems to be lifted from Disney Infinity‘s popular Toy Box mode, where players could create and share worlds using characters from tons of Disney-owned properties.
Seeing as this is all the information Disney has released so far, it is hard to know if these are just articulated toys, or if there is a digital interactive element that will accompany these toys. The ad does say “interact” but that could simply be a reference to the posable joints on the figures.
Ex-Avalanche Software executive producer John Vignocchi replied to a chain of Tweets, offering some more insight into this new product line.
There are a lot of questions left unanswered, but it seems that we will find out more on November 3, when these are scheduled to start releasing online and in-store on shopDisney.com.

It seems that Disney has taken serious note of all the fan-made Mouse Ears that have become increasingly popular in recent years.
Releasing over the course of the Fall season, Disney has created a bunch of new Mouse Ears to appeal to fans of all iconic Disney designs and colors.
Disney has prefaced the announcement with news that more of the incredibly popular rose gold headbands will be available sometime in November.
In addition to all the new headbands, Disney in also releasing a line of interchangeable bows to accompany the many new headbands. These bows resemble a variety of Disney characters, as well as designs that are synonymous with some classic Disney films. The best part is that these bows are available now.
If headbands aren’t your thing, Disney also has a few new ear hats on the way. As of now, we only know that they are also being released this fall, so expect to see them all in the parks soon after Halloween. We actually spotted the baseball caps yesterday at Hollywood Studios.
All of the new headwear will be available throughout Walt Disney World and Disneyland Resorts. Some of the headbands and hats will also be available on the Shop Disney Parks app and shopDisney.com.
Just arrived from Japan, Disney Ufufy are the latest plush craze, and they are now available at ShopDisney.com!
Several different sizes are available. Medium are 12″ and retail at $16.95. Small are 4.5″ and retail at $6.95. Mini are 2.5″ and come as sets of two for $9.95. They are also all scented, for some reason.
As of now, only a selection of characters are available, including the Fab 6 (Mickey, Minnie, Goofy, Pluto, Donald, Daisy), Stitch, Chip ‘n Dale, Pooh, Piglet, Eeyore, Tigger, and Marie.
